RegisterEastern Market After Dark (EMAD) is a signature component of the Detroit Month of Design. EMAD is a district wide night market and open-studio involving several galleries, retailers, brand activations, and music. Introduced as part of the festival programming in 2012, EMAD has grown from an initial attendance level of 4,000 to attracting more than 25,000 attendees in 2019 and featuring the work...
